Most people here do not even know how the forex market operates. I recently participated in an investment bank simulation and my results are attached: If you all knew how the market operates, you will know why investment banks always make billions from this market and the retail traders just keep floundering. All I did to generate these results was to make the markets for premium clients, then offload them on retail brokers, who would in turn resell the positions to their retail clients. You can NEVER beat the sell side participants. If your trades are not going in their direction, forget it. Making such returns that MBA Forex was promising its clients as a retail trader is IMPOSSIBLE. Trust me, I know it from an insiders point of view.
